Join the power movement as a Fiber Optic Specialist The Fiber Optic Specialist on the SPARC Assembly Team is an exciting and evolving role with a responsibility for performing all aspects of optical fiber work such as fiber handling, splicing, testing, and incorporation of fibers into complex design features in the process of assembling our fusion machine. The technician will ensure functional installation, health, and operation of the fibers, as well as look for opportunities for continuous improvement. Responsibilities include close cooperation with Operations, Engineering, Quality, and other departments to ensure goals and objectives are met. This role will lead the way to making Earth sustainable for the future to come. This work is conducted within a multi-disciplinary team of technicians and engineers. Participation and clear, concise communication while working with the team is crucial.
